2022 Presidential Address--Educational Historians in an Epoch of Change: Unite, Support, Contribute
Platt, R. Eric
American Educational History Journal, v50 n1 p15-25 2023
In this 2022 Organization of Educational Historians Presidential Address, Platt states that in the face of a world fettered by anti-intellectualism, racism, sexism, homophobia, and class disparity; as well as harmful state legislation that hampers academic freedom, heightens political disunion, and frustrates social justice; it is essential that now and, in the future, academic researchers--specifically educational historians--come together to support one another and promote honest dialogue and scholarship production.
